The Challenges of Obtaining a Paintball Scholarship

Unlike traditional sports such as football or basketball, paintball does not have a well-established system for awarding scholarships. This is due in part to the fact that paintball is not recognized as an official sport by the National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A). The NCAA is responsible for overseeing and regulating college sports in the United States, and their lack of recognition for paintball makes it difficult for players to receive scholarships through traditional means.

Another challenge is the lack of funding and resources for paintball programs at the collegiate level. While some schools may have a dedicated paintball team, many do not have the budget to support it. This means that players often have to cover their own expenses, making it difficult to justify the cost of a scholarship.

Furthermore, paintball is not a widely televised or popular sport, which means there is less exposure and recognition for players. This makes it harder for them to showcase their skills and attract the attention of potential sponsors or scholarship providers.
